What is Odisha PGMEE?

Odisha PGMEE (Odisha Post Graduate MedicalEntrance Exam) is a state-level entrance examination conducted for admission into postgraduate medical courses such as MD (Doctor of Medicine) and MS (Master of Surgery) in medicalcolleges across Odisha.

This exam plays an important role for medical graduates who wish to pursue advanced specialization in fields like medicine, surgery, pediatrics, orthopedics, and more. It ensures that candidates are evaluated based on their academic knowledge, clinical understanding, and aptitude.

Over time, the admission process in India has shifted toward centralized systems like NEET PG. However, understanding Odisha PGMEE remains important for state quota admissions, eligibility conditions, and counselling processes within Odisha.

Eligibility Criteria

Before applying, candidates must carefully check the eligibility requirements. These criteria ensure that only qualified candidates participate in the admission process.

Basic Eligibility

  • Educational Qualification: Must have an MBBS degree from a recognized medical college.
  • Internship Completion: Candidates must complete their compulsory internship before the specified deadline.
  • Registration: Must be registered with the Medical Council of India or State Medical Council.

Domicile Requirement

  • State Residency: Candidates must be residents of Odisha or meet domicile criteria.
  • Proof Required: Valid documents such as domicile certificate or residence proof.

Minimum Marks

  • General Category: Minimum qualifying marks as per official guidelines.
  • Reserved Categories: Relaxation in marks as per government norms.

FAQ ( Frequently Asked Questions)

1. What is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: Odisha PGMEE (Odisha Post Graduate Medical Entrance Exam) is a state-level entrance exam conducted for admission into postgraduate medical courses such as MD and MS in medical colleges of Odisha.

2. Is Odisha PGMEE still conducted for PG medical admissions?

Answer: Currently, admissions to PG medical courses are mainly conducted through NEET PG. However, Odisha PGMEE guidelines are still relevant for state quota eligibility and counselling processes.

3. What courses are offered through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: The exam provides admission to postgraduate medical courses such as MD (Doctor of Medicine) and MS (Master of Surgery) in various specializations.

4. What is the eligibility criteria for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: Candidates must have an MBBS degree from a recognized institution, complete their internship, and be registered with the Medical Council of India or State Medical Council.

5. Is domicile required for Odisha PG medical admission?

Answer: Yes, candidates must fulfill Odisha domicile requirements to be eligible for state quota seats in medical colleges.

6. What is the exam pattern of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: The exam generally consists of multiple-choice questions based on the MBBS syllabus, with a duration of around 3 hours and approximately 200 questions.

7. Is there negative marking in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: Negative marking may be applicable depending on the official exam pattern, so candidates should check the latest notification before appearing.

8. How can I apply for Odisha PG medical admission?

Answer: Candidates need to register online, fill out the application form, upload required documents, pay the application fee, and submit the form through the official portal.

9. How is the Odisha PGMEE merit list prepared?

Answer: The merit list is prepared based on candidates’ performance in the entrance exam or NEET PG scores, depending on the admission process in that year.

10. What is the counselling process for Odisha PG medical admission?

Answer: Counselling includes registration, choice filling, seat allotment, document verification, and final admission to allotted colleges.

11. What documents are required during counselling?

Answer: Candidates must submit MBBS degree certificate, internship completion certificate, ID proof, domicile certificate, and other relevant documents.

12. What is the duration of PG medical courses?

Answer: The duration of MD and MS courses is generally 3 years.

13. Are private medical colleges included in Odisha PG admissions?

Answer: Yes, both government and private medical colleges participate in the counselling and admission process.

14. What is the difficulty level of Odisha PGMEE?

Answer: The exam is considered moderate to difficult, as it covers the complete MBBS syllabus including clinical subjects.

15. How can I prepare for Odisha PGMEE effectively?

Answer: Focus on revising core concepts, solving previous year papers, taking mock tests, and concentrating on high-weightage clinical subjects.
